Books by Lesley Sims

Lesley Sims is a much‑loved children's author celebrated for her lively storytelling and gentle humour. Her books often introduce young readers to timeless tales and original adventures told in clear, rhythmic language that supports early reading confidence. Sims' work is frequently paired with engaging illustrations, creating an inviting first step into the world of literature for little ones.

Across her catalogue, from retellings of classic fables to imaginative early readers, she combines educational value with a sense of fun. Teachers and parents alike appreciate her skill in balancing accessible vocabulary with stories that spark curiosity and empathy, making her titles a trusted choice in classrooms and home libraries throughout the UK.

    Book SynopsisLesley Sims (Author) Lesley dreamed of being a writer, but studied law as her mother insisted she had something to fall back on. Since joining Usborne Publishing, she has written and edited hundreds of books, from funny rhyming stories to an award-winning history book. Nowadays, she is often found recording books, too, in Usborne's very own recording studio.

  • Roman Soldiers Handbook

    Usborne Publishing Ltd Roman Soldiers Handbook

    15 in stock

    Book SynopsisOffers an introduction to Roman history. This survival guide for studious centurions is about how to stay alive in the Roman army. It reveals all the gruesome truths of life in the Roman army including what soldiers ate, wore and how they lived.Trade ReviewA great introduction to the dynamics of the Roman Army. Military manuals are known to have been used by the Roman Army, and this book provides an educational but entertaining way of putting ancient history into modern hands. The tone of the handbook is informal, which is far more appealing to students than a dry textbook. The language used promotes interactivity, and addresses the reader directly. There are also mini quizzes throughout the book. * Heritage Key website *An educational but entertaining way of putting ancient history into modern hands * Heritage Key website *Get your child immersed in Roman history as they read this essential guide for everyone joining the Roman army. The quirky cartoon-style illustrations add a great deal of detail to this fascinating book which is an excellent accompaniment to KS2 history. * parentsintouch.co.uk *It’s good for kids because the diagrams and pictures are cartoony. I’d recommend it to my teacher and kids of 7 and up. I’d give it VIII out of X! * Reader Review, British Museum Remus Magazine *
